Apparatus and method for securing mobile terminal
Abstract
A mobile terminal and a method for securing information are provided. The mobile terminal includes an application part to receive information related to an application; a determining unit to receive a command issued by the application and to determine whether the command or the application is authorized to access a system resource of the mobile terminal; and a blocking unit to block an execution of the command in response to a determination that the execution of the command is unauthorized or issued by the unauthorized application. The method includes receiving information related to an application; receiving a request for executing a command issued by the application; determining whether the requested command or the application is authorized to access a system resource of a mobile terminal; and blocking execution of the command in response to a determination that the execution of the command is unauthorized or issued by an unauthorized application.

1 . A method for securing information in a mobile terminal, comprising:
setting reference information for determining whether to block an unauthorized command; detecting a request for executing a command issued by an application; determining, using the reference information, whether the requested command or the application is authorized; blocking execution of the command in response to a determination that the execution of the command is unauthorized or issued by an unauthorized application; and executing the command in response to a determination that the execution of the command is authorized or issued by an authorized application.
